Output 5028807c6692b05da144f5580f8c3c3d0d2ba557452e21fcfe8d63a56de868ce:15

value
1204313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3be25c65a881e6b9f37b69bf9d8c5010a3c43c OP_EQUAL
address
3JwbNdQFSsWCAA5kVkyYrSW3mANaouLq18
transaction
5028807c6692b05da144f5580f8c3c3d0d2ba557452e21fcfe8d63a56de868ce
confirmations
101590
spent
true